EAST RUTHERFORD, N.J. -- When the New Orleans Saints are limited to 13 points, its easy to point a finger at No. 9 and say its Drew Brees fault.Well guess what? The 37-year-old quarterback wasnt all that bad Sunday in a 16-13 loss to the New York Giants.Brees didnt throw any interceptions and the Saints didnt turn the ball over. The offense just could not get it going against a revamped Giants defense.Big bucks went a long way in fixing a unit that allowed 52 points and surrendered seven touchdown passes to Brees and the Saints last year in a 52-49 win by New Orleans.And just maybe, the Giants defense is that good this year after spending $100 million in the offseason to sign sack threat Olivier Vernon, run stopper Damon Harrison and shutdown cornerback Janoris Jenkins. Add in cornerback Eli Apple and safety Darian Thompson in the draft, and this unit held its own against Brees.Both teams went out and made improvements on the defensive side of the ball, said Brees, who completed 29 of 44 passes for 263 yards and a touchdown. Both sides came in with a great game plan and so we knew it was going to be a hard-fought game. We thought our output would be better offensively than it was today.The Saints had chances, but they did not capitalize. They were 3 of 13 on third down and that was a major factor in the game. The Saints only had the ball for 59 plays and just under 26 minutes in time of possession, gaining 288 yards.In last years game, New Orleans had a combined 79 runs and passes and 35 minutes of possession. They gained 614 net yards.Thats 20 extra plays and Brees can do a lot with that.It wasnt pretty, but we got the job done as a defense. Im happy, and its going to get better, Giants defensive end Jason Pierre-Paul said. Were still trying to get chemistry with each other. As a unit, we still have a lot of work to do. The vibe is totally different. We know what it takes and its not an individual goal but to correct the mistakes that we made.Brees was frustrated, especially wasting a great effort by his own defense, which forced three turnovers and did not allow a touchdown. New Yorks TD came on Jenkins return of a blocked field goal.If you told me prior to the game that we would get three takeaways defensively and not allow an offensive touchdown, Id say our chances today are pretty good, Brees said. The unfortunate thing is that the blocked field goal that gets returned for a touchdown is a 10-point swing. So thats pretty devastating when you look at the way the game unfolded and then the way it finished.The Giants did an outstanding job of keeping the Saints receivers in front of them. In last years game, Brees three longest touchdowns were 53, 34 and 26 yards. His longest completion on Sunday was 23 yards.New York also made the Saints one-dimensional, limiting their running game to 41 yards on 13 carries. The Saints had 103 on 26 carries last season.We stopped the run and we were definitely getting Brees off of his spot, so that he doesnt see those open receivers if he has any and just make a play when he throws the ball, said safety Landon Collins, who had one of the Giants two sacks.Giants coach Ben McAdoo said the key for the Giants was keeping the ball away from Brees.They played fantastic, whistle-to-snap, McAdoo said of his defense. We got lined up quickly. We made sure we had our eyes where they needed to be. They played the call and they played with confidence.Brees had a couple of chances against the defense, but he did not come through.I think that I didnt do a great job of handling some of their third-down pressure stuff to sustain drives, Brees said. We got into some third-and-long situations, or third-and-longer than probably we should have. Two players from United Bank Limited, a Pakistan first-class team, were injured in a fire that broke out at the Regent Plaza Hotel in Karachi on Monday.In an accident that left at least 11 people dead and 45 injured, allrounder Yasim Murtaza fractured his heel while 20-year-old legspinner Karamat Ali suffered a hand injury in a bid to save themselves. Ten players from UBL, along with Umar Amin, who plays for Sui Southern Gas Corporation, were staying at the hotel for the ongoing super-eight round of the Quaid-e-Azam Trophy, Pakistans premier first-class tournament.UBL were playing Habib Bank Limited, and were set to resume their first innings on 20 for 0 on the third day, in response to Habib Banks 486. Having received a request to abandon the match from UBL manager Nadeem Khan, the PCBs domestic committee agreed to do so, awarding both teams a point each.According to Nadeem, the players woke up to fire and smoke at around 3.30am in the fourth floor of the building. According to reports the fire broke out in the kitchen, which is on the ground floor of the four-star hotel located on the citys Shahrah-e-Faisal, and swept through the building. Cricketers were trapped between the second and fourth floors and were rescued from the hotel afterr three hours.ddddddddddddI got a call from a player for help, Nadeem told ESPNcricinfo. When I rushed to the hotel, I saw them screaming for help in the windows. They were naturally suffocating after the smoke entered their rooms through the central air-conditioning system. They tried to make their way outside to escape, but couldnt go beyond the second floor.Yasim, however, jumped from second to first floor and broke his heel bone, while Karamat Ali suffered a hand injury. The rest of the boys are fine and didnt suffer any life-threatening injury at all, but they were given oxygen as they were suffocating with the smoke.The affected cricketers, after a check-up, were temporarily residing at UBL captain Shan Masoods house in Karachi.All the players have been evacuated and moved to a safer location now, Nadeem said. They are shocked, however, and are not in state to carry on with the match. With two of our boys getting injured, all are in severe shock. Our team is mentally handicapped and cant play the match any more.GMT 1030 The story was amended after the PCB domestic committee decided to abandon the match. ' ' '
